x86: Move DSDT table to a writer function

Move this table over to use a writer function, moving the code from the
x86 implementation.

Add a pointer to the DSDT in struct acpi_ctx so we can reference it later.

Disable this table for sandbox since we don't actually compile real ASL
code.

// SPDX-License-Identifier: GPL-2.0+
/*
* Write the ACPI Differentiated System Description Table (DSDT)
*
* Copyright 2021 Google LLC
*/
#define LOG_CATEGORY LOGC_ACPI
#include <common.h>
#include <acpi/acpi_table.h>
#include <dm/acpi.h>
#include <tables_csum.h>
/*
* IASL compiles the dsdt entries and writes the hex values
* to a C array AmlCode[] (see dsdt.c).
*/
extern const unsigned char AmlCode[];
int acpi_write_dsdt(struct acpi_ctx *ctx, const struct acpi_writer *entry)
{
const int thl = sizeof(struct acpi_table_header);
struct acpi_table_header *dsdt = ctx->current;
int aml_len;
/* Put the table header first */
memcpy(dsdt, &AmlCode, thl);
acpi_inc(ctx, thl);
log_debug("DSDT starts at %p, hdr ends at %p\n", dsdt, ctx->current);
/* If the table is not empty, allow devices to inject things */
aml_len = dsdt->length - thl;
if (aml_len) {
void *base = ctx->current;
int ret;
ret = acpi_inject_dsdt(ctx);
if (ret)
return log_msg_ret("inject", ret);
log_debug("Added %lx bytes from inject_dsdt, now at %p\n",
(ulong)(ctx->current - base), ctx->current);
log_debug("Copy AML code size %x to %p\n", aml_len,
ctx->current);
memcpy(ctx->current, AmlCode + thl, aml_len);
acpi_inc(ctx, aml_len);
}
ctx->dsdt = dsdt;
dsdt->length = ctx->current - (void *)dsdt;
log_debug("Updated DSDT length to %x\n", dsdt->length);
return 0;
}
ACPI_WRITER(3dsdt, "DSDT", acpi_write_dsdt, 0);
